Influence of Sleep on Hunger Hormones



Getting enough sleep plays a critical duty in controling appetite hormonal agents, impacting your cravings and food options. When you do not obtain adequate sleep, it can disrupt the balance of vital hormones that control appetite and satiety, causing raised desires and over-eating.

Here's how sleep affects your hunger hormonal agents:

- ** Leptin Levels **: Rest starvation can decrease leptin levels, the hormonal agent in charge of signifying volume to your brain. When leptin levels are low, you might feel hungrier and less pleased after eating.

- ** Ghrelin Levels **: Absence of sleep has a tendency to increase ghrelin levels, the hormone that stimulates cravings. Elevated ghrelin degrees can make you yearn for much more high-calorie foods, causing potential weight gain.

- ** Insulin Level Of Sensitivity **: Poor sleep can decrease insulin level of sensitivity, making it harder for your body to control blood sugar level levels. This can result in increased cravings and a greater risk of creating insulin resistance.

Prioritizing high quality sleep can assist maintain a healthy and balanced balance of these cravings hormonal agents, supporting your weight loss efforts.
